Report: Hugh Jackman Won't Serve as 2010 Oscar Host

He may have brought song and levity to the 2009 Oscars, but despite the rumors, Hugh Jackman won't be back to host the 2010 ceremony.

Sources told Variety that the Australian actor recently turned down the job.

According to the Hollywood trade magazine, Hugh isn't opposed to hosting the Oscars again, he just didn't want to do it two years in a row.

The father of two is currently starring on Broadway in "A Steady Rain," opposite British heartthrob Daniel Craig.

He has a host of projects on the horizon including a dramatic film, "The Real Steel," which begins shooting in Spring 2010, the mag reported.

The 2010 Oscars will take place on March 7.
